Accepting Your Dark Side
In Chinese Philosophy, Yin and Yang represent the concept that all things exist as inseparable and contradictory opposites. According to Chinese mythology, Yin and Yang were born from chaos when the universe was created and are believed to live in harmony at the center of the Earth.
